Still Disappointed After 10 Months

Last year, I had written a previous review regarding this app along with an update of my ongoing experience. Neither was complimentary and oddly enough that original review appears to have been deleted. In any event, after having converted to this app from OnCue last year, my experience with this app has been nothing short of maddening. It is not hyperbole when I state that this app spends more time offline than being accessible. I receive multiple daily notifications advising it is offline, then back online, then back to offline, back to online, so forth and so on. Never, ever experienced these connectivity issues with OnCue over the course of the two prior years we had the generator installed. I’ve had conversations with Kohler support which proved to be fruitless (sorry guys, but it is NOT an internet issue). I’ve been thru several firmware updates that seemingly fix the problem for a week or two only to have things revert back to intermittent connectivity issues. So, my original one star rating from 10 months ago remains unchanged. The generator itself is fantastic; unfortunately, the app is utterly craptastic.

Several functions do not work

The app has several flaws.
1) Under the exercise menu it shows that you can edit the date and time of the exercise program. It does not work. It says it’s saving the changes but it simply does not.
2) Under the controller menu it shows you can edit the date and time. I’m away from home and due to daylight saving I tried to charge the time to correct it. But it won’t save the corrected time.
3) Another big issue is due to the extreme cold weather the generator failed to start for the weekly exercise and sent an error code. The app will not allow to clear the error. I had to bother a family member to go to my house and manually access the generator to clear the error. I find not being able to clear an error remotely very disappointing, disruptive and rendered the generator useless.

Not an improvement over the previous app

This app moves backwards with communication capabilities over the previous. When we lose power in our area, we also lose internet service. When the power is restored and internet is restored, it’s a guess whether connection with the OnCue server will also be restored. Twice now after power / internet service was down and restored, the connection with the server was not restored. Even after multiple attempts at completely shutting down and restarting the network, no success. To restore the connection, I have to perform a “pretend” firmware update on the generator and both times, that process restored the connection. I never had to do this with the old OnCue app.

Unable to update Controller Time

Personally I found the old OnCue app more reliable/stable from reading parameter info to performing change requests to generator.
This app has improved over the last year but one issue I still have is submitting a time change request. Twice a year I have to manually adjust the time on the generator (RES20A-installed 2016) due to DST. Request either time outs after 3-5 minutes or simply returns to main screen with the time set to what it was prior (no change). Frustrating.
